Harrison Township’s Active Adults program for seniors 55 and older is hosting chair yoga classes every Tuesday at American Legion Post 452. The next class will take place Tuesday from 11 a.m. to noon.

This class is ideal for all fitness levels and is led by a certified yoga instructor who uses a chair for support to show participants how to improve flexibility, balance and strength while relieving stress.
